欢迎来到三人行教育网,代理招生网站!

吴忠切换城市

咨询热线 400-6169-615

位置:三人行教育网,代理招生网站 > 吴忠新闻资讯 > 吴忠教育新闻 > 吴忠教育要闻 >  梧州达内专业软件测试培训价格,欢迎咨询试学!

梧州达内专业软件测试培训价格,欢迎咨询试学!

来源:三人行教育网,代理招生网站

2023-01-22 11:28:41|已浏览:27次

梧州达内专业软件测试培训价格
达内软件测试培训学校励志语录:要想人前显贵,必先人后受罪。
.


软件测试 | web功能测试的常见检查点

软件测试工程师一直是很多小伙伴眼中的香饽饽,不用学习太多的代码还可以拿不错的薪资,实在是招人喜爱,今天小编就给大家总结一下软件测试 | web功能测试的常见检查点,希望可以帮助到大家。
检查点:
1、检查每个连接是否都有对应的页面;检查页面之间可以正确切换。
2、检查按钮的功能,如Add, update, delete, save, cancel。
3、检查输入框:
(1)字符串长度,检查输入超出需求所说明的长度的内容,会不会出错。
(2)字符类型检查:输入指定类型的地方输入其他类型的内容,检查是否报错。
(3)回车键检查:在输入结束后直接按回车键,看系统处理如何,会否报错。
4、上传下载文件检查上传下载文件的功能是否实现,上传文件是否能打开。
5、必填项:检查应该填写的项没有填写时系统是否都做了处理,对必填项是否有提示信息,如在必填项前加*。
6、检查多次使用back键的情况:在有back的地方,back,回到原来页面,再back,重复多次,看会否出错。
7、Search功能:在有search功能的地方输入系统存在和不存在的内容,看search结果是否正确。如果可以输入多个search条件,可以同时添加合理和不合理的条件,看系统处理是否正确。
8、检查删除功能:在一些可以一次删除多个信息的地方,不选择任何信息,按“delete”,看系统如何处理,会否出错;然后选择一个和多个信息,进行删除,看是否正确处理。
9、相关性检查:删除/增加一项会不会对其他项产生影响,如果产生影响,这些影响是否都正确。
10、检查带出信息的完整性:查看信息和update信息时,查看所填写的信息是不是全部带出,带出信息和添加的是否一致。
11、快捷键检查:是否支持常用快捷键,如Ctrl+C Ctrl+V Backspace等。软件测试培训网格言:如果容许我再过一次人生,我愿意重复我的生活。因为,我向来就不后悔过去,不惧怕将来。——蒙田.
梧州达内专业软件测试培训价格



达内软件测试培训学校励志语录:才华是血汗的结晶。才华是刀刃,辛苦是磨刀石。.
线上出现bug测试人员怎么办

常在河边走,哪能不湿鞋,即使测试在工作中已经小心再小心了,但有时还是可能会出现线上问题,真是个悲伤的故事,然而纵然悲伤也需要有个结局,那么项目上线出现bug,测试人员该肿么办呢?
首先要做的是重现这个问题并反馈给研发人员,尽快出patch或者解决方案。
当BUG解决且上线没有问题之后,我们再看后续的处理。
追查原因及处理方法:这个BUG出现的原因是什么。这有分为几种情况:
1)测试环境无法重现:可能是线上的环境造成的BUG或者是测试环境无法模拟的情况。
解决方法:尽量完善测试方法、尽量模拟测试环境、增加线上测试。
2)漏测:
a.测试用例裁剪过度:错误预估优先级或者时间过于紧迫裁剪了用例
解决方法:在后续版本或者其他项目启动时重新评估测试时间,要求专家介入对优先级进行评估,避免此类事件再次发生。
b.测试用例执行期间遗漏:由于测试人员疏忽造成测试用例执行遗漏。
解决方法:调查该名测试人员的整个测试过程的工作情况,并随机抽测其他模块,对该名测试人员进行综合评估,给出结论,是因为偷懒漏测,还是因为负责模块过多漏测,还是有其他原因,对该名测试人员发出警告,对相关测试主管,项目经理,产品经理发出警告。
c.测试用例覆盖不全:由于用例评审的不严格造成的;中途需求变更造成的;由于某些其他因素造成的。
解决方法:找到原因,并进行记录,在以后的项目或者下一版本重点关注。
最最重要的:补测试用例!
最后说说追责,一般来说,上线的BUG不能完全归咎于某个人,或者是归咎于测试部、研发部,这是一个团队合作的过程,除了纰漏谁也逃不掉,应该及时止损,吸取教训,在今后的版本或者项目中避免类似的问题发生。当然,如果真的是某个人的责任,那么项目组就应该考虑,是否继续任用他了!软件测试培训达内荣誉:2014年10月,荣膺中国经济网2014年度“最具价值在线教育机构”奖。


梧州达内专业软件测试培训价格
软件测试培训网格言:没有方法能使时钟为我敲已过去了的钟点。——拜伦
。Android 手机自动化测试工具有哪几种
基于优秀的图像对比库opencv的测试工具,测试脚本使用Python编写,非常强大。
如果你的app没有源码,可以选择它;或者你想做系统测试(跨app的测试),也可以选择它。
先说说开源的吧:
Robotium
Monkeyrunner
Robolectric
CTS
还有个新兴的测试工具,以前在GitHub看到,现在找不到了,好像是BDD类型的语法,现在还不成熟。
另外基于web的测试也有基于Selenium Webdriver 的 Android WebDriver:
有两种,基于Remote Server的。
官方提供了java接口的,但是Python版的官方里面却没有。
Python版,GitHub:https://github.com/truebit/AndroidWebDriver4Python
基于Instrumentation的,已经在Android SDK r14里面可以安装了。
不开源的就多了,不过我见过的一般是以下几种思路:
1. 基于Android Java Instrumentation框架。基于Robotium,比如bitbar的产品,http://bitbar.com/products
基于Instrumentation,那就海了去了,很多公司自家写的工具都基于这个,另外Robotium就是基于这个的
2. 基于Android lib层的各种命令,比如sendevent,getevent, monkey, service这些,然后用各种语言封装。
MonkeyRunner还是很有前景的,Google自己弄的。现在最新的dev版本已经有支持UI的id操作的EasyMonkey了。
以分类的角度来说
1)纯白盒方式的测试,Monkey。楼上已经有哥们提到了,使用moneky更多的是开发team,而不是纯粹的测试team,毕竟要求对android开发比较了解才用得了monkey。
2)偏白盒的robotium,这家伙号称是黑盒,但是本人不太认同~ 因为使用robotium需要知道package和acitivity这样的细节,即便不是开发人员来做,也得从开发人员那里获得不少开发文档才能做。
3)纯黑盒的方式,这个分类比较有意思,我分得细点。
3-1)sikuli,原来只针对桌面应用,后来自然延伸到了android app,让人眼前一亮的测试方式。框个图,写个简单的python测试脚本(其实java脚本也可以),测试就做好了,简单又形象,还有逻辑。因为验证点是依赖于图片比对,所以瓶颈也在此。屏幕大小和分辨率的不同是这种测试的硬伤,如果测试团队觉得每个手机上抠下来的图要重新截,那…也就没啥了。
3-2)testin,deviceanywhere等
楼上那个哥们应该是testin的人,介绍已经很全面了,我只概括一下。这类测试本身没有神马特别的,无非是放在了云端,将规模化的测试做到了极致,与其说是测试工具,不如说是测试平台。说缺点嘛也有,由于只是简单的基于坐标的脚本录制(并没有灵活的功能性验证点),这种测试往往比较简单,只是做做简单的适配性和性能测试,毕竟卖点不在测试类型上。
3-3)clicktest论原理,也是基于图片对比技术,只是做了些优化,比对的智能一些,跨手机的效果更好罢了。也支持录制回放,自定义了一些测试命令,易上手,可读性强,不再需要使用者(手工测试人员)编程了。另外,支持工作流式的逻辑集成,可以灵活得组合测试步骤,增强复用性。clicktest是工具,不是平台,欢迎各位咨询和探讨。
4)硬件辅助的测试方式,我就不举例了
先说原理,硬件辅助视频输出(摄像头or视频线),控制方式是软硬件结合。这种方式的特点,跨平台杠杠的,但是成本高,包括硬件成本以及硬件工程师的成本。达内软件测试培训学校励志语录:我要让未来的自己为现在的自己感动。。
梧州达内专业软件测试培训价格



专业软件测试培训座右铭:低头要有勇气,抬头要有底气。——韩寒.
  • 相关阅读